Etihad goes Five Star

Etihad Airways has received the Skytrax “Certified Five Star Airline Rating” after a three month audit of the airline’s global product and service by Skytrax.

A few couple of things about this are interesting:

  1. This brings the number of five star airlines in the world to nine: ANA, Asiana, Cathay Pacific, EVA Air, Garuda Indonesia, Hainan, Qatar, and Singapore. Malaysia used to have a five star rating but that was lost.
  2. This means of the big Middle Eastern carriers, Qatar and Etihad are five stars and Emirates is four
  3. I am a little cynical about the rating system. Why is Emirates the best airline in the world according to Skytrax and only gets four stars? How does that work?
  4. Etihad withdrew from the Skytrax rating system in 2014 and 2015 questioning the ratings organisations research methods and conclusions. Now just two years later, Etihad is back and wins five star status.
